Course Description
This course covers the following unit of competency:
ICTICT101 Operate a personal computer
If you have never used a computer or struggle to understand and function a computer, our course will equip you with the knowledge and methods to confidently operate a computer either for your own personal use or for employment. You will be introduced to the world of computing, learning the basics of navigating around a computer, accessing and organising files and programs, sending and retrieving emails, using the internet, connecting digital media devices and applying basic security procedures and power management settings.
Course Requirements:
No prior computer knowledge is required to attend this course. Students need to bring a USB flash drive.
A Statement of Attainment will be issued for units completed in this course.
